优草派  >   Python

jdbc连接

孙悦            来源:优草派

是Java中进行数据库操作的重要手段之一。JDBC是Java Database Connectivity的缩写,它是一种用于连接和操作各种数据库的API。在Java中,JDBC是一种标准的API,任何实现了JDBC规范的数据库都可以使用JDBC连接。JDBC连接的作用

JDBC连接主要用于Java程序与数据库之间的通信。通过JDBC连接,Java程序可以与各种数据库进行交互,包括MySQL、Oracle、SQL Server等。JDBC连接可以实现很多数据库操作,例如查询、插入、更新、删除等。JDBC连接还可以实现事务处理、批量操作等高级功能。

jdbc连接

JDBC连接的实现方式

JDBC连接有两种实现方式,分别是基于JDBC驱动和基于数据源连接池。基于JDBC驱动的连接方式是最基本的连接方式,它使用JDBC驱动程序连接到数据库,并执行SQL语句。基于数据源连接池的连接方式则是更加高级的连接方式。数据源连接池是一个缓存连接的集合,可以提高连接的效率和性能。

JDBC连接的步骤

JDBC连接的步骤包括加载数据库驱动、建立连接、创建Statement对象、执行SQL语句、处理结果集等。其中,加载数据库驱动是连接数据库的第一步,Java程序需要使用Class.forName()方法加载数据库驱动。建立连接是连接数据库的第二步,Java程序需要使用DriverManager.getConnection()方法建立连接。创建Statement对象是执行SQL语句的第一步,Java程序需要使用Connection.createStatement()方法创建Statement对象。执行SQL语句是执行SQL语句的第二步,Java程序需要使用Statement.executeQuery()或Statement.executeUpdate()方法执行SQL语句。处理结果集是执行SQL语句的最后一步,Java程序需要使用ResultSet对象来处理结果集。

JDBC连接的优缺点

JDBC连接的优点是可以连接多种数据库,支持多线程,支持事务处理等。JDBC连接的缺点是需要编写大量的JDBC代码,容易出现代码重复,不便于维护。此外,JDBC连接也存在一些性能问题,例如连接池管理不当、数据类型转换等问题。

JDBC连接的应用场景

JDBC连接可以应用于各种场景,例如Web应用程序、客户端应用程序、移动应用程序等。Web应用程序是JDBC连接的主要应用场景之一,Java程序可以通过JDBC连接与Web服务器上的数据库进行交互。客户端应用程序也可以通过JDBC连接与本地数据库进行交互。移动应用程序则可以通过JDBC连接与云端数据库进行交互。

【原创声明】凡注明“来源:优草派”的文章,系本站原创,任何单位或个人未经本站书面授权不得转载、链接、转贴或以其他方式复制发表。否则,本站将依法追究其法律责任。
TOP 10
  • 周排行
  • 月排行